Team Newspublished at 19:37 British Summer Time 31 July
Linfield v Zalgiris (Agg 0-0 - 19:45 BST)
With the tie delicately poised at 0-0 from the first leg in Lithuania, both sides make changes for tonight's win-or-bust encounter at Windsor Park.
David Healy introduces Ben Hall in the heart of defence, replacing the injured Euan East, who limped off during the first half in Vilnius.
FK Žalgiris welcome back the imposing Vasilije Radenovic from suspension - a boost for the visitors after the defender's enforced absence following his red card against Hamrun Spartans.
Giedrius Matulevicius also comes into Vladimir Cheburin's starting XI as Dino Salcinovic and Ebenezer Ofori make way.
